Baltimore at New England First Half Open Thread

We may not be happy about the Steelers not playing in the game, but we all know if the Steelers aren't playing in the game, this is the most compelling AFC Championship match-up possible.

The Patriots, former tormentors of the Steelers and the team accused of cheating its way to an AFC title in 2004 take on the hated Ravens, one half of the best rivalry in all of sports.

It's high drama, however you slice it. We won't be happy with either team winning, but there's not much that can be done about it now. A natural disaster seems a bit too much to ask for, and it's a good bet one of these two teams will be going to Indianapolis in two weeks. Yes, I shudder at the thought.

As it is, it makes for great football, so lock in to BTSC with your favorite beverage and/or food item, I'll be here throughout, so let's talk the game, or the draft or even your thoughts on Sunday afternoon laziness.
